      My Sky HD remote has been getting tatty for a while and my small pile of remotes is annoying. So I finally got around to buying a universal remote to do the TV and Sky boxes and control the Amazon TV and it’s Kodi from an android app.

      I got the £11 One for All Essence 2 URC 7120 for 2 devices (they do single, triple and quad versions too). If you go to the website  you can search for the setup codes for your devices rather than go through the printed tables in the manual. I was very vague on model numbers so it gave me multiple codes to try but the top ones worked first time.

      One clever aspect is the “combi” button. When watching Sky all I need the TV to do is turn on and off and adjust the volume, so these keys are dedicated to the TV and the rest control the Sky box. The power switch works on both boxes simultaneously. If you need to do anything more complex you just put the remote in dedicated TV or SAT mode.
